Quick Answer: Which Is The Fastest And Most Expensive Memory In Memory Hierarchy?

Which is the fastest memory RAM or cache?

CPU cache memory operates between 10 to 100 times faster than RAM, requiring only a few nanoseconds to respond to the CPU request.

The cache provides a small amount of faster memory that’s local to cache clients, such as the CPU, applications, web browsers and OSes, and is rapidly accessible..

Why is memory hierarchy important?

Memory hierarchy is particularly important for understanding optimizations and performance costs that happen at the hardware level. Storing data on disk versus main memory can impact running time. … A ‘memory hierarchy’ in computer storage distinguishes each level in the ‘hierarchy’ by response time.

What is ROM in memory?

Read-Only Memory (ROM), is a type of electronic storage that comes built in to a device during manufacturing. … Non-volatile memory like ROM remains viable even without a power supply.

Which memory has shortest access?

Discussion ForumQue.Which of the following memories has the shortest access times?b.Magnetic bubble memoryc.Magnetic core memoryd.RAMAnswer:Cache memory1 more row

Which level of memory has the highest cost per bit?

register fileMemory. Computer systems have a hierarchy of memory, as shown in the diagram on the right. At the top is the register file in the CPU. This memory has the highest cost per bit, the smallest capacity, and the shortest access time.

Which is lowest in memory hierarchy?

Most modern computer systems use a hard drive made of magnetic or solid state storage as the lowest level in the memory hierarchy (see Figure 8.4). … It provides a much larger capacity than is possible with a cost-effective main memory (DRAM).

Which memory is faster primary or secondary?

Typically primary memory is six times faster than the secondary memory. Primary memory, i.e. Random Access Memory(RAM) is volatile and gets completely erased when a computer is shut down.

Which of the memory is fastest?

Fastest memory is cache memory.Registers are temporary memory units that store data and are located in the processor, instead of in RAM, so data can be accessed and stored faster.More items…•

Which memory required more cost?

The most expensive memory is in-CPU memory such as registers and internal instruction queues. While it is difficult to calculate the price, it is clearly more than tens of dollars per kilobyte.

Is ROM or RAM faster?

RAM is a high-speed memory, with reading-write operations, happen at a fast pace whereas ROM is slower speed memory, which is less prone to modification and can be done via an external program.

What is the fastest most expensive memory in your computer?

Cache memoryA typical computer has 3 types of memory: Cache memory, Random Access Memory (RAM), and virtual memory. Cache is the fastest and most expensive, RAM is slower and less expensive, and virtual memory is the slowest and least expensive type.

What is memory hierarchy explain?

In computer architecture, the memory hierarchy separates computer storage into a hierarchy based on response time. Since response time, complexity, and capacity are related, the levels may also be distinguished by their performance and controlling technologies.

Which memory has highest storage capacity?

Storage Capacity of Floppy Disc = 1.44 Megabytes. Storage Capacity of CD-ROM = 650 Megabytes (Approx.).

Which memory has the highest cost per bit?

The memory hierarchy in datacenters typically consists of different types of memory as shown in Figure 1. The on-chip SRAM memory at the top of the pyramid is the fastest, but also the most expensive and hence provisioned in limited quantity.

Which is the fastest storage unit in a usual memory hierarchy?

In a computer, a register is the fastest memory. Register a part of the computer processor which is used to hold a computer instruction, perform mathematical operation as storage address, or any kind of data. The register memory indicates the capacity of the register to hold the size of data it can hold.

What is main memory in memory hierarchy?

Typically, a memory unit can be classified into two categories: The memory unit that establishes direct communication with the CPU is called Main Memory. The main memory is often referred to as RAM (Random Access Memory). The memory units that provide backup storage are called Auxiliary Memory.

What are included in the memory hierarchy?

The memory in a computer can be divided into five hierarchies based on the speed as well as use. The processor can move from one level to another based on its requirements. The five hierarchies in the memory are registers, cache, main memory, magnetic discs, and magnetic tapes.